中国东北和俄罗斯远东两地产能合作的现状、问题及对策--基于“一带一路”倡议

摘    要:在"一带一路"倡议下,中国东北地区和俄罗斯远东地区在基础设施、能源、制造业以及农业等领域开展了广泛的合作。然而,中俄双方对产能合作准备不足且缺乏有效的互信机制,加上俄罗斯远东地区基础设施落后、制度环境较差,使得双方产能合作成效有限。双方必须尽快构建合作共赢机制,建立产能合作共同体,加速推进双方产业结构升级,为中国东北地区和俄罗斯远东地区产能深度合作夯实基础。

Abstract:Under the "Belt and Road Initiative", the extensive cooperation in the fields of infrastructure, energy,manufacturing and agriculture has been carried out between Northeast China and the Far East Federal District of Russia. However, the effectiveness of production capacity cooperation between China and Russia is limited on account of the lack of preparation for production capacity cooperation between the two sides and the lack of effective mutual trust mechanism,coupled with the backward infrastructure and poor institutional environment in the Far East Federal District of Russia. The two sides must build a win-win cooperation mechanism as soon as possible, establish a community of capacity cooperation and accelerate the upgrading of the industrial structures in the two countries so as to lay a solid foundation for the in-depth cooperation between Northeast China and the Far East Federal District of Russia.
